Punjab assembly's 358 members take oath

01 June, 2013

LAHORE: Punjab assembly's 358 members out of the total strength of 371 have taken oath on Saturday here, our sources reported.

Among those who took oath, about 150 new faces have for the first time become members of the assembly, sources said.

Muslim League-Nawaz (ML-N) has the highest number of members in the Punjab assembly, which includes 246 seats of general and 7 of minorities, while 50 female reserved seats also in the ML-N fold.

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) trailing behind has 20 general seats, 5 female reserved seats and 1 of minority.
